BILLBOARD (USA) MAGAZINE'S (MAGAZINE'S CHART) TOP SINGLES OF 1961

 


  1 TOSSIN' & TURNIN'-BOBBY LEWIS-BELTONE-AUGUST
  2 I FALL TO PIECES-PATSY CLINE-DECCA-August
  3 MICHAEL-HIGHWAYMEN-UNITED ARTIST-September
  4 CRYING-ROY ORBISON-Monument-October
  5 RUNAWAY-DEL SHANNON-Big Top-April
  6 MY TRUE STORY-JIVE FIVE-Beltone-September
  7 PONY TIME-CHUBBY CHECKER-Parkway-March
  8 WHEELS-String Alongs-Warwick-March
  9 RAINDROPS-Dee Clark-Vee Jay-July
 10 WOODEN HEART-Joey Dowell-Smash-August
 11 Calcutta-Lawrence Welk-Dot-February
 12 Take Good Care Of My Baby-Bobby Vee-Liberty-October  
 13 Running Scared-Roy Orbison-Monument-June
 14 Dedicated To The One I Love-Shirelles-Scepter-March
 15 Last Night-Mar keys-Satellite-August
 16 Will You Love Me Tomorrow-Shirelles-Scepter-February
 17 Exodus-Ferrante & Teicher-United Artist-February
 18 Where The Boys Are-Connie Francis-MGM-March
 19 Hit The Road Jack-Ray Charles-ABC Paramount-October
 20 Sad Movies-Sue Thompson-Hickory-October
 21 Mother-In-Law-Ernie K.Doe-Minit-May  
 22 Bristol Stomp-Dovells-Parkway-November
 23 Travelin' Man-Ricky Nelson-Imperial-May
 24 Shop Around-Miracles-Tamla-February
 25 Boll Weevil Song-Brook Benton-Mercury-July
 26 A Hundred Pounds Of Clay-Gene McDaniels-Liberty-May
 27 The Mountain's High-Dick & Dee Dee-Liberty-September
 28 Don't Worry-Marty Robbins-Columbia-March
 29 On The Rebound-Floyd Cramer-RCA-April
 30 Portrait Of My Love-Steve Lawrence-United Artist-May
 31 Quarter To Three-Gary U.S.Bonds-Legrand-July
 32 Who Put The Bomp-Barry Mann-ABC Paramount-September
 33 Calendar Girl-Neil Sedaka-RCA-February
 34 I Like It Like That-Chris Kenner-Instant-August
 35 Apache-Jorgen Ingmann & His Guitar-Atco-March
 36 Don't Bet Money Honey-Linda Scott-Canadian American-September  
 37 Without You-Johnny Tillotson-Cadence-September
 38 Wings Of A Dove-Ferlin Husky-Capitol-February
 39 Little Sister-Elvis Presley-RCA-October
 40 Blue Moon-Marcels-Colpix-April  
 41 Daddy's Home-Shep & Limelights-Hull-May   
 42 This Time-Troy Shondell-Liberty-October
 43 But I Do-Clarence Frogman Henry-Argo-April  
 44 Asia Minor-Kokomo-Felstead-April
 45 Hello Walls-Faron Young-Capitol-June
 46 Runaround Sue-Dion-Laurie-October   
 47 Yellow Bird-Arthur Lyman Group-Hi Fi-July  
 48 Hurt-Timi Yuro-Liberty-September  
 49 Hello Mary Lou-Ricky Nelson-Imperial-May
 50 There's A Moon Out Tonight-Capris-Old Town-February  
 51 Surrender-Elvis Presley-RCA-March  
 52 I Love How You Love Me-Paris Sisters-Gragmark-November
 53 Ya Ya-Lee Dorsey-Fury-October
 54 School Is Out-Gary US Bonds-Legrand-September
 55 Mexico-Bob Moore-Monument-October   
 56 Walk Right Back-Everly Brothers-Warner Brothers-April
 57 You Don't Know What You've Got(Until You Lose It)-Ral Donner-Gone-September
 58 The Way You Look Tonight-Lettermen-Capitol-October
 59 Moody River-Pat Poone-Dot-June       
 60 One Mint Julep-Ray Charles-Impulse-May
 61 Take Good Care Of Her-Adam Wade-Coed-May
 62 Gee Whiz-Carla Thomas-Atlantic-March
 63 Stand By Me-Ben E. King-Atco-June   
 64 Spanish Harlem-Ben E.King-Atco-March
 65 It's Gonna Work Out Fine-Ike and Tina Turner-Atco-September
 66 Baby Blue-Echoes-Segway-April    
 67 Baby Sittin' Boogie-Buzz Clifford-Columbia-March
 68 Hats Off To Larry-Del Shannon-Big Top-August
 69 Those Oldies But Goodies-Little Caesar & The Romans-Del fi-June
 70 The Fly-Chubby Checker-Parkway-November
 71 Marie's The Name) His Latest Flame-Elvis Presley-RCA-September
 72 Wonderland By Night-Bert Kaempfert-Decca-January
 73 Bless You-Tony Orlando-Epic-October
 74 I've Told Every Little Star-Linda Scott-Canadian American-May
 75 One Track Mind-Bobby Lewis-Beltone-September     
 76 Angel Baby-Rosie & Originals-Highland-February  
 77 Pretty Little Angel Eyes-Curtis Lee-Dunes-August
 78 Think Twice-Brook Benton-Mercury-March  
 79 Does Your Chewing Gum Lose Its Flavor-Lonnie Donegan-Dot-September
 80 Breakin' In A Brand New Heart-Connie Francis-MGM-May  
 81 Mama Said-Shirelles-Scepter-May
 82 Let The Four Winds Blow-Fats Domino-Imperial-August
 83 Writing On The Wall-Adam Wade-Coed-July  
 84 My Kind Of Girl-Matt Monro-Warwick-August
 85 Tonight My Love Tonight-Paul Anka-ABC Paramount-April
 86 San Antonio Rose-Floyd Cramer-RCA-July
 87 Big Bad John-Jimmy Dean-Columbia-November
 88 Good Time Baby-Bobby Rydell-Cameo-March
 89 Rubber Ball-Bobby Vee-Liberty-January
 90 Missing You-Ray Peterson-Dunes-September
 91 Dum Dum-Brenda Lee-Decca-August   
 92 I'm Gonna Knock On Your Door-Eddie Hodges-Cadence-August
 93 You Can Depend On Me-Brenda Lee-Decca-May    
 94 Let's Twist Again-Chubby Checker-Parkway-August  
 95 Take Five-Dave Brubeck-Columbia-November
 96 Are You Lonesome Tonight-Elvis Presley-RCA-January
 97 Sea Of Heartbreak-Don Gibson?RCA Victor-August
 98 More Money For You & Me-Four Preps-Capitol-September
 99 You Must Have Been A Beautiful Baby-Bobby Darin-Atco-October
100 Please Stay-Drifters-Atlantic-July
